Abstract
We report the first measurement of time-dependent CP asymmetry in B-0 -> K-S(0)rho(0)gamma decays based on 657 x 10(6) B (B) over bar B pairs collected with the Belle detector at the KEKB asymmetric-energy collider. We measure the CP-violating parameter S-KS0 rho 0 gamma = 0.11 +/- 0.33(stat)(-0.09)(+0.05)(syst) from a signal of 212 +/- 17 events. We also obtain the effective direct CP-violating parameter A(eff) = 0.05 +/- 0.18(stat) +/- 0.06(syst) for m(KS0 pi+pi-) < 1.8 GeV/c(2) and 0.6 GeV= c(2) < m(pi+pi-) < 0.9 GeV/c(2).
